## Formula sandbox tuning

User-supplied formulas in Gridmoor execute inside a restricted interpreter with hard ceilings on time, memory, and call depth. Reviewers should confirm any change to these ceilings is justified in the PR description, since raising them widens the abuse surface. Defaults were chosen from production traces. The current limits are as follows.

limits module of tafog-fawip:
WEIGHTS = {
    "julix": 57,
    "lamys": 992,
    "kasvan": 209,
    "quenok": 750,
    "alddor": 259,
    "oliath": 1009,
    "wenix": 815,
}

Subject: Regional numbers — quick readout

Hi all,

Quick summary before Thursday's session: the Westmarch region beat target by 7%, mostly thanks to the Orlan Pro refresh, while Caldbeck came in flat again. Ines will circulate branch-level detail tomorrow. Let's keep the tone constructive with the regional leads — we need them onside for Q4. One point I'd rather not put in the wider pack is set out just below.

confidential, tafog-fahif: The renewal with Wenixox Holdings closes at $20 million a year, 20 percent above the last contract. Project Holath slips by six weeks because of the audit delay.

Ticket DGST-412: Digest scheduler fires twice when cron window crosses midnight.

Repro:
1. Set MailBatch digest to 23:55 on staging.
2. Enqueue 50 messages.
3. Observe duplicate sends at 23:55 and 00:00.

Affects all tenants on the Quillport cluster. To replicate against the scheduler API, authenticate with the bearer token below.

login token, bagug-kafop: eyJhbGciOiJIUzI1NiIsInR5cCI6IkpXVCJ9.eyJzdWIiOiIcMLov2In0.Z5RLDIfp

Step 4: Publish the fixture build. Once the Fablemint test-data factory library passes its own suite, package it with `mint pack` and push to the internal registry at Corvid. The registry rejects unsigned packages, so sign the tarball first using the contractor deploy key issued for this engagement. Run `mint sign` from the package root and confirm the digest matches the build log. Sign with the key below.

rollout seal: bky4_x7Gc